Transaction 0615646916b70d574631b2ebda1a200fda70d57f24df9778633c9faee7482ef6
1 Input
1 Output
-
0615646916b70d574631b2ebda1a200fda70d57f24df9778633c9faee7482ef6:0
- value
- 1384279
- script pubkey
- OP_0 OP_PUSHBYTES_20 56efc8111798897bc4b99e1bdece0adeb7aaa928
- address
- bc1q2mhusyghnzyhh39encdaans2m6m642fg87ksrh